Abstract: | Oxidative C-H functionalization represents a crucial method to make new C-C, C-X (X = heteroatom) bonds. An optimal selection of the oxidizing agent goes hand in hand with the insight into the reaction mechanism. This review covers recent advances in methods of direct oxidative C-H functionalization of azines and their derivatives with heteroaromatic nucleophiles. Also we review the data on application of inorganic and organic oxidants for implementation of these reactions. C-H functionalizations under electrochemical and photocatalytic oxidation conditions are included as well. © AUTHOR(S) |
